Job Title: Chief Manager - HSE
- Identify unsafe acts and unsafe conditions and recommend corrective measures in coordination with the concerned personnel.
- Conduct hazard identification and risk analysis (HIRA) and propose countermeasures to the relevant departments and management.
- Plan and execute various HSE training programs to enhance employee skills and awareness.
- Implement IMS (Integrated Management System) standards and strengthen the Emergency Response Team (ERT).
- Manage and respond to first aid requirements and activities.
- Cross-verify the work permit system and maintenance checklists, escalating issues in a timely manner.
- Report safety deviations and observations, particularly in ride areas, and coordinate with relevant departments for corrective action.
- Review and analyze injury and illness data from the First Aid station and recommend appropriate preventive measures.
- Ensure the effective implementation of the Lockout/Tagout (LOTO) system.
- Implement safety measures for new projects and construction activities.
- Ensure compliance with State Pollution Control Board norms and legal requirements.
- Oversee the implementation, monitoring, and continuous improvement of the Safety Management System.
- Conduct mock drills and training programs related to HSE, IMS, and First Aid.
- Perform internal, external, and vendor safety audits.
- Organize Safety Committee meetings and deliver safety talks for shop floor employees.
- Implement and manage health processes in alignment with organizational standards.
- Drive process excellence initiatives to improve efficiency.
- Ensure effective implementation of the 6S methodology to enhance customer service excellence.
- Monitor and enforce adherence to organizational grooming and personal hygiene standards.
